Espag handles are the most popular type of handle that is used in uPVC windows in the present and work with the espagnolette multipoint lock system. Cockspur handles and blade handles or spade handles are also available.

Window-Repairs.-150x150.jpguPVC

The presence of damaged locks and handles on your uPVC windows could make your home vulnerable to burglars, however it's easy to replace them. There are certain indications to look out for to tell whether your uPVC windows handles or locks require replacement. For instance, your handle might feel a bit loose or difficult to turn when opening the window. This could be a sign of wear and tear or it could be a sign that the handle is broken.

There are a variety of uPVC window handles. Espag handles are the most common kind of handle found on uPVC windows today, but they are also found on windows made from aluminium and timber. They operate with the multipoint espagnolette lock which is inserted into the frame of the window, offering additional security. They can be locked or non-lockable and are available in a variety of colors.

Another type of uPVC replacement window handle is the spade handle sometimes referred to as blade handles. They are similar to cockspur handles but they have a shorter spindle. They are used on some uPVC and older wooden double glazed windows. They can be utilized in conjunction with trickle vents.

When selecting a brand new uPVC window handle replacement, it's crucial to consider the spindle size and the screw centre. Spindle length refers to how much the spindle extends out from the back of the handle. It can be measured by comparing the handle to another on the same window. If the uPVC window handle is tilt and turn, it is important to consider the step height. The standard heights for step heights of uPVC tilt-and-turn handles are 21mm. It is crucial to make sure that the new handle also includes this measurement.

Over time, the handles of windows get loose. The handle can rotate in a 360-degree circle without opening the window, or it could even break off the base. If this is the case it's a good idea to replace the entire handle, not just the handle head.

You must match the step-height between the new handle and the existing uPVC tilt-and-turn windows. This is the distance between the handle's nose and the screw plate which secures the handle to the frame. The standard step height is 21 millimeters, so you'll need to ensure that the new handle you buy is in line with this.

To measure the changing window handles you'll need to remove the handle. Be careful not to harm the window when you do this. The easiest method for doing this is by unscrewing the handle from the frame, and then removing the screws that are exposed. Replace the screw covers once you're finished. Once you've matched the spindle length and step height of the new handle to the old ones, you're able to install it.

Espag (or cockspur), window handles are found on uPVC or aluminium double glazed Windows that have a multi-point locking mechanism for enhanced security. They can be locked to prevent the window opening at all internally and unlocked to allow the window to open to let air flow in. This kind of handle is generally a little more bulky than other types because they have a long spindle that runs the locking mechanism inside the window.

They can be either in-line or cranked, depending on the style of your existing window. In-line handles can be turned right or left and they are straight. Cranked handles feature a grip that is slightly off from the central locking position for additional security.

Typically, they have a larger backset size than a conventional cockspur handle to ensure that they are compatible with the locking system of your windows. They are available in various finishes, and are suitable for both aluminum and uPVC window frames. If you're looking for a more modern replacement for your current handle then a slimline option might be the best choice for you as they usually have a smaller spindle and can save on space in areas where blinds or shutters are installed. These handles are available in various colours and can be matched with any ironmongery you have.

For chrome window handles for double glazing, there are a number of different styles to pick from. A lot of them have a traditional appearance that will add a stylish touch to any uPVC window. The most popular type of handle is the espagnolette style, which is an elongated strip that moves when turned. This type of handle comes in both left and right-hand designs.

A popular alternative to the standard espagnolette handle is the cockspur handle, which has an elongated nose that fits into an elongated wedge on the window frame. These are slim and sturdy, making them perfect for older windows. They are available in various finishes including stainless steel and brass.

If your upvc casement window handle window handles are becoming stiff, you may need to replace the spindle which fits them. This may happen over time, and is typically caused by dirt getting into the mechanism that operates the handle. It is also possible that your window isn't closing correctly, which can cause gaps for air leakage and cold draughts.

The mechanism of your uPVC windows handles may be loosened and stop working. This could mean that windows are in need of replacement, or it may be due to movement or subsidence within the building materials. In any case, it's worth having the issue examined by a professional to ensure that the problems are resolved.
